Earl Cooper for Congress: A Campaign Built on Faith, Community, and Real-World Impact


Earl Cooper for Congress

In an era where many voters feel disconnected from politics, Earl Cooper is positioning himself as a different kind of candidate—one shaped not by political ambition, but by community action and lived experience.


Running for Congress in Delaware, Cooper’s campaign centers on a simple but compelling message: leadership should be earned through service, not titles.


A Leader Rooted in Community, Not Politics

At the heart of Cooper’s campaign is a strong critique of traditional politics. He emphasizes that Delaware doesn’t need more career politicians—it needs leaders who have already demonstrated a commitment to their communities.


Rather than building a résumé through political offices, Cooper points to a lifetime of hands-on work:

  • Creating job opportunities for youth in Wilmington

  • Developing pathways to affordable homeownership

  • Building businesses that provide fair wages and dignity to workers


His message is clear: results matter more than rhetoric.


Turning Challenges Into Opportunities

One of the defining themes of Cooper’s platform is economic empowerment—particularly for underserved communities.


His work includes initiatives like housing programs that allow individuals to earn homeownership through “sweat equity,” helping bridge the gap for families who might otherwise be locked out of the housing market.

This approach reflects a broader philosophy:

People don’t just need assistance—they need opportunity.

By focusing on ownership, job creation, and workforce development, Cooper aims to address the root causes of economic disparity rather than just its symptoms.
